The lease, simply

One side computes at a time.

A twin is not two copies fighting over the same files. It is one session with a lease that says who is allowed to change things right now. The lease flips only after a sync has been confirmed.

laptop holds the lease ─── you work ─── close the lid │ push + confirmcloud holds the lease ─── jobs keep running, keepalive every 15 min │ you open the lid │ pull + confirmlaptop holds the lease again ─── nothing was lost, nothing was overwritten

Shutdown handoff

On lid close or shutdown the plugin pushes your session, waits for the cloud to confirm, then hands over the lease. If the push fails, the lease stays with the laptop and nothing runs twice.

Checkpoints

Snapshot the twin at any moment, with a comment. Restore any of them later. Plus keeps 5, Pro 30, Studio 100.

Sync back

When you return, the laptop pulls what changed in the cloud, confirms, and takes the lease back. Only the differences travel, over an encrypted tunnel.

Keepalive, not runaway

While the cloud holds the lease it must renew every 15 minutes. Set a maximum of cloud hours per handoff and it will never quietly run for a week.

A starting point for agents

Start a Sandbox from a copy of your twin and a new agent begins with your tools and dotfiles, minus every credential.

Twin in your browser

Your desk, from any screen.

Open the Cloud dashboard, pick your twin, press start. Your session is there, in a terminal in the browser, running on the twin's own cloud machine.

  • Terminal today, desktop next

    The browser terminal works now. The full Hyprland desktop streamed to the browser is on its way.

  • Stops itself

    After 30 idle minutes it stops, and it never outlasts the twin's cloud-hour cap. The meter stops with it.

  • Honest about the lease

    If your laptop still holds the lease, the dashboard says so: changes you make in the browser are replaced by the laptop's next push unless you hand the lease to the cloud first.
